JOINT CIRCULAR

Guidelines for financial management of experimental production projects supported by state budget funds

___________________________________

Pursuant to the State Budget Law and Decree No. 60/2003/NĐ-CP dated June 6, 2003 of the Government detailing and guiding the implementation of the State Budget Law;

Pursuant to Decree No. 118/2008/NĐ-CP dated November 27, 2008, of the Government stipulating the functions, tasks, powers, and organizational structure of the Ministry of Finance;

Pursuant to Decree No. 28/2008/NĐ-CP dated March 14, 2008, promulgated by the Government stipulating the functions, tasks, powers, and organizational structure of the Ministry of Science and Technology;

Pursuant to Decision No. 62/2010/QĐ-TTg dated October 15, 2010 of the Prime Minister on not recovering state budget funds supporting experimental production projects of products;

The Ministry of Finance and the Ministry of Science and Technology issue guidelines for financial management of experimental production projects supported by state budget funds as follows:

Article 1. General Provisions

These Circular applies to experimental production projects (hereinafter referred to as SXTN projects) supported by state budget funds to implement research programs and technology development priorities determined in the national science and technology development strategy and priority scientific fields of ministries, ministerial-level agencies, government agencies, provinces, centrally governed cities (hereinafter collectively referred to as ministries, sectors, provinces, cities), including:

a) National-level SXTN projects comprising: Independent projects, projects under national key science and technology programs, projects under national science and technology projects, projects under science and technology programs and plans according to the Prime Minister's Decision No. 62/2010/QĐ-TTg dated October 15, 2010.

b) SXTN projects at the ministry, sector, provincial, and city levels.

2. These Circular does not apply to SXTN projects funded from the National Science and Technology Development Fund or other support funds.

3. State budget funds supporting the implementation of SXTN projects shall be allocated in the annual budget for science and technology activities of ministries, sectors, provinces, and cities in accordance with the State Budget Law and current implementing regulations.

4. Standards, procedures, and processes for reviewing SXTN projects supported by state budget funds shall be carried out in accordance with the guidance of the Ministry of Science and Technology in other documents.

Article 2. Specific Provisions

1. Contents eligible for state budget support

a) Costs for improving and innovating technology; completing and innovating production lines (improving and innovating technological processes, decoding foreign technologies, establishing optimal technological processes, technical design, product design of the project, improving and innovating production lines, supplementing or replacing equipment and testing tools... ) to implement SXTN projects.

b) Costs for producing the first batch of products of the project (purchase of seeds, raw materials; energy consumption costs; labor hiring costs...);

c) Costs for purchasing foreign technical documents (which are not available domestically);

d) Costs for consulting and hiring experts;

đ) Costs for leasing, purchasing, and importing specialized equipment directly serving the project;

e) Costs for training and instructing managers, technical staff, skilled workers, farmers (for agricultural SXTN projects)... directly serving the project;

f) Costs for inspecting and analyzing research results during the experimental process;

i) Costs for quality inspection of products and goods resulting from the project;

k) Costs for promotion, marketing, registering industrial property rights or registering plant varieties;

g) Other direct costs serving the implementation of the project (excluding travel expenses abroad, interest on loans incurred by the project owner due to borrowing funds to implement the project on the part of the organizing body);

2. Level of support from state budget sources

The state budget supports:

- Up to 30% of the total new investment cost necessary for the implementation of the project approved by the competent authority (excluding the residual value or depreciation costs of existing equipment and facilities);

- Up to 50% of the total new investment cost necessary for the implementation of SXTN projects in agriculture and projects implemented in areas with difficult socio-economic conditions as stipulated in Decision No. 30/2007/QĐ-TTg dated March 5, 2007 of the Prime Minister on issuing the list of administrative organizations in difficult regions and subsequent amendments and supplements (if any);

- Up to 70% of the total new investment cost necessary for the implementation of SXTN projects in agriculture implemented in areas with difficult socio-economic conditions as stipulated in Decision No. 30/2007/QĐ-TTg dated March 5, 2007 of the Prime Minister on issuing the list of administrative organizations in difficult regions and subsequent amendments and supplements (if any).

3. Approval Authority for Support Levels

The approval authority for specific support levels for each project is as follows:

a) For national-level SXTN projects

- Independent SXTN projects, SXTN projects under national key science and technology programs, SXTN projects under national science and technology projects: The Ministry of Science and Technology decides the level of state budget support for each project based on the total new investment cost necessary for the implementation of the project according to Clause 2 of this Article.

- SXTN projects under science and technology programs and plans approved by the Prime Minister or delegated by the Prime Minister to ministries and sectors for approval and management: Ministries and sectors managing the projects decide the level of state budget support for each project based on the total new investment cost necessary for the implementation according to Clause 2 of this Article and according to separate circulars guiding these programs and plans.

b) For SXTN projects at the ministry, sector, provincial, and city levels: Ministries, sectors, People's Committees of provinces, and cities decide the level of state budget support for each type of project based on the total new investment cost necessary for the implementation of the project according to Clause 2 of this Article.

Article 3. Financial management for projects

The preparation, allocation, implementation, and settlement of state budget support funds for projects shall be based on the provisions of Circular Joint No. 44/2007/TTLT-BTC-BKHCN dated May 7, 2007 guiding the construction standards and budget allocation for science and technology topics and projects funded by the state budget; Circular Joint No. 93/2006/TTLT-BTC-BKHCN dated October 4, 2006 guiding the system of cost allocation for science and technology topics and projects funded by the state budget, and shall be implemented according to the provisions of the State Budget Law and current guiding documents, any replacing, amending, and supplementing documents (if any), and some guidance points in this Circular as follows:

1. Preparation and allocation of annual state budget expenditure

Each year, based on the approved budget for the entire project implementation phase (including state budget support funds), the progress of project implementation, organizations prepare the state budget expenditure plan and submit it to the competent authority (the Ministry of Science and Technology for national-level S&T projects; relevant ministries and sectors for S&T projects under programs and plans approved by the Prime Minister and assigned to manage; ministries, sectors, and provincial People's Committees for S&T projects at the ministry, sector, and provincial levels).

Ministries, sectors, provinces, and cities consider and consolidate the state budget expenditure plan for S&T projects supported by the state budget into their own budget revenue and expenditure plan according to regulations (in detail, by national-level, ministry-sector-level, and provincial-level projects).

Based on the allocated budget revenue and expenditure plan, ministries, sectors, provinces, and cities develop plans to allocate and assign state budget expenditures for implementing S&T projects to the leading organizations and implementing organizations according to current regulations.

Leading organizations of S&T projects that do not receive regular annual state budget allocations (such as enterprises, collectives, households, or scientific and technological organizations, public institutions implementing projects through bidding or commission from other organizations receiving state budget allocations) must enter into a scientific and technological contract with the approving agency or authorized agency to implement the project. The contents of the scientific and technological contract shall be carried out according to the regulations of the Ministry of Science and Technology.

2. Issuance, implementation of the budget plan, and settlement of state budget support funds for implementing S&T projects shall be carried out according to the provisions of the State Budget Law and current guiding documents.

3. Inspection of S&T project implementation

a) The competent authority approving the S&T project is responsible for organizing periodic or spot inspections of project implementation in coordination with the financial department at the same level and related agencies, specifically as follows:

- For national-level S&T projects not included in key science and technology programs: The Ministry of Science and Technology will lead and coordinate with relevant ministries, sectors, provinces, cities, and the Ministry of Finance to conduct inspections.

- For S&T projects under programs and plans managed by ministries and sectors: Relevant ministries and sectors will lead and coordinate with the Ministry of Science and Technology, relevant ministries, sectors, provinces, cities, and the Ministry of Finance to conduct inspections.

- For national-level key science and technology program S&T projects: Implementation shall follow the current regulations on the organization and management of national-level key science and technology program activities.

- For ministry and sector-level S&T projects: Relevant ministries and sectors will lead and coordinate with the Ministry of Science and Technology and the Ministry of Finance to conduct inspections.

- For provincial-level S&T projects: The Department of Science and Technology will coordinate with the main managing agency and the Department of Finance to conduct inspections.

b) Inspection content: The implementation of the project regarding progress, scientific and technological contents, etc., according to the signed scientific and technological contract, and the use of funds, including both state budget funds and other mobilized capital by the implementing organization.

During the inspection process, the ratio between state budget funds and other mobilized capital should be considered.

4. Responsibility for implementing S&T projects

The leading and principal organizations of the project are responsible for ensuring the implementation of the terms stipulated in the signed scientific and technological contract, mobilizing sufficient sources of funding as committed to implement the project, using funds for the intended purpose, complying with standard regulations, and reporting on the use of state budget funds according to regulations.

5. Handling violations of the scientific and technological contract for implementing S&T projects

a) Projects that fail to ensure the mobilization of sufficient non-state budget funds to match the implementation of the project as committed in the scientific and technological contract:

Based on the actual situation and the impact of changes in funding sources on the content and results of the project, the competent authority approving the specific support level for each project (as stipulated in Clause 3, Article 2 of this Circular) will consider and decide on adjusting the support level or recovering the support funds; specifically as follows:

- In cases where the leading and principal organizations of the project can prove objective factors leading to insufficient matching funds: The competent authority approving the support level will consider and decide to adjust the total project budget and increase the state budget support level but must ensure that it does not exceed the support ratio specified in Clause 2, Article 2 of this Circular.

- In cases where the leading and principal organizations of the project cannot prove objective factors leading to insufficient matching funds, the competent authority approving the support level will consider and decide:

+ To reduce the state budget support level according to the proportion of reduced non-state budget funds mobilized compared to the total project budget estimate if such a reduction does not change the expected project outcome.

In the case where adjusting the reduction of state budget funding leads to changes in the expected results of the project, it is required that the leading and principal organizations of the project must mobilize additional corresponding funds from sources outside the state budget to achieve the approved results. If the leading and principal organizations of the project do not confirm the additional corresponding funds, the competent management authority shall issue a decision to stop the implementation of the project and require the leading and principal organizations of the project to return the entire amount of state budget funds already supported to the state budget. The source of funds returned to the state budget: 50% shall be borne by the Project Principal for repayment; 50% from various Funds and other self-owned sources of the leading organization.

b) For projects that are not completed (including projects that must be stopped according to the decision of the competent management authority or projects evaluated at the level of "unsatisfactory") due to reasons other than the mobilization of corresponding funds outside the state budget as stipulated in point a, Clause 5 of this Article:

- Within fifteen working days from the date of receipt of the document determining that the project must be stopped or is not completed issued by the competent state management authority, the leading and principal organizations of the project are responsible for preparing a detailed report on the entire process of implementation (content of activities and fund usage) of the project; clearly identifying the causes and submitting them to the competent state management authority for approval of the project.

- Within thirty working days from the date of receipt of the report from the leading and principal organizations of the project, the competent state management authority approving the project shall be responsible for checking and determining the causes leading to the failure of the project.

- The competent state management authority shall issue a specific decision to handle as follows:

The leading and principal organizations of the project are responsible for:

+ Returning to the state budget all state budget funds that have been allocated but not yet used;

+ Recovering and returning to the state budget up to 100% of the state budget funds that have been used for the project.

Based on the actual situation (the amount of funds invested in the experimental production project, objective and subjective factors leading to the failure of the project, the ability to recover funds from the sale of project products and assets, etc.), the competent state management authority shall consider and decide on the specific amount to be recovered in accordance with the actual implementation of the project. The source of funds returned to the state budget: 50% shall be borne by the Project Principal for repayment; 50% from various Funds and other self-owned sources of the leading organization.

c) Within three hundred and sixty days from the date the competent authority approving the project issues a decision regarding the return of funds to the state budget, the leading and principal organizations of the project are responsible for returning the funds to the state budget according to the current budget management hierarchy.

In cases where the deadline has expired and the leading and principal organizations of the project have not returned the funds to the state budget, the budget estimate for the next year of the leading agency will be reduced accordingly. For organizations leading projects that are not regularly allocated state budget funds annually, they will not be considered for participation in SXTN projects for two years from the date of the decision to stop the project.

- In cases where the existing sources of Funds and other self-owned sources of the leading organization are insufficient to return the funds to the state budget, the remaining funds shall continue to be returned to the state budget in the following year.

- Organizations leading projects shall compile the situation of recovering funds returned to the state budget into their annual settlement reports and submit them to the higher-level supervisory agencies for consolidation and submission to the financial authorities at the same level in accordance with regulations.

d) Other forms of handling for organizations leading and principal organizations of projects that are not completed shall be specified by the Ministry of Science and Technology in other documents.

đ) The Project Principal, the leading organization of the project, and related organizations and individuals must return to the state budget the funds that were used for purposes, in violation of regulations, standards, and prescribed quotas.

6. Report on the use of funds

Every six months, the leading organizations of the projects shall submit a report on the use of corresponding sources of funds in relation to the volume of work implemented to the approving authority.

Ministries, sectors, provinces, and cities shall submit annual consolidated reports on the support funds for SXTN projects to the Ministry of Science and Technology and the Ministry of Finance before the preparation of the budget for support funds for the following year.

Article 4. Organization of Implementation

1. This Circular takes effect from April 8, 2011, and replaces Circular Joint No. 85/2004/TTLT-BTC-BKHCN dated August 20, 2004, of the Ministry of Finance and the Ministry of Science and Technology guiding financial management for scientific and technological projects supported by the state budget and subject to recovery of funds.

2. Scientific and Technological Experimentation and Transfer (SXTN) projects supported by the state budget that have been approved and are being implemented by the competent state management authority before the effective date of this Circular shall continue to be implemented in accordance with the provisions of Circular Joint No. 85/2004/TTLT-BTC-BKHCN dated August 20, 2004, of the Ministry of Finance and the Ministry of Science and Technology.

3. SXTN projects specified in Decision No. 62/2010/QĐ-TTg dated October 15, 2010, of the Prime Minister regarding non-recovery of funds supported by the state budget for SXTN product projects approved after December 1, 2010, shall be implemented in accordance with this Circular.

4. Within twelve months from the effective date of this Circular, ministries, sectors, provinces, and cities shall be responsible for inspecting and evaluating the recovery of funds, coordinating with the financial authorities at the same level to consider and handle exemptions and reductions in the recovery of funds for SXTN projects approved before the effective date of this Circular within their jurisdiction, compiling and reporting the situation and results of implementation to the Ministry of Science and Technology and the Ministry of Finance.

During the implementation, if there are difficulties or obstacles, please reflect them to the Ministry of Finance and the Ministry of Science and Technology for research and appropriate amendments and supplements. /
